Will you have a miscarriage if take sleep aid?
In general, it is recommended that women avoid taking any medications during pregnancy, especially during the first trimester. This is because the developing fetus is most vulnerable to damage during this time. However, if you are suffering from insomnia, you may need to take a sleep aid to help you get rest.
If you are considering taking a sleep aid during pregnancy, be sure to talk to your doctor first. They will be able to assess your individual needs and recommend the best course of treatment. They may also suggest alternative methods of getting relief from insomnia, such as:
* Establishing a regular sleep schedule
* Creating a relaxing bedtime routine
* Avoiding caffeine and alcohol before bed
* Getting regular exercise
* Seeing a therapist for help managing stress
